LFSADRG
07-24-2012, 11:25 AM
Low 12's. If you can get out of the hole hard without wheel hop, tire spin or stub breakage and power shift then I could see a high 11 with that HP.
moge11
07-24-2012, 02:18 PM
Expect 120mph trap speeds with DECENT Hook... if it dont hook, it will NOT MPH or ET worth a shit....
